Across TCGA cell cohorts, TMEM102 RNA expression is significantly associated with the go_rna of many other GO terms, with 3,542 significant associations in total. BONE sh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ible TMEM102-associated GO terms across cancer lineages are Cytotoxic T cell degranulation, Endosomal transport, and T cell mediated cytotoxicity. Each is linked with TMEM102 in more than 12 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both TMEM102-to-partner and partner-to-TMEM102 results are reported.

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The box plot shows the strongest example, Cytotoxic T cell degranulation grouped by TMEM102-low versus TMEM102-high in STOMACH.
